Top 5 Shooter Games Performance in Switzerland Q1 2023

In Q1 2023, the top 5 shooter games on a unified platform in Switzerland showed diverse trends in their performance metrics. Here's a detailed look at their we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.

PUBG MOBILE exper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$109K in the last week of March. Weekly downloads saw a general decline, starting at around 2.1K in late December and dropping to around 1.4K by the end of March. The game's weekly active users remained relatively stable, hovering around 26K throughout the quarter.

Call of Duty®: Mobile showed a varied revenue trend, with the highest point reaching $75.6K in the last week of December and another peak of $58.4K at the end of March. Weekly downloads decreased over the quarter, starting at about 3K and ending at approximately 1.6K. Active users also saw a decline from about 53K in late December to around 42K by the end of March.

War Robots Multiplayer Battles had a more stable performance. Revenue peaked at around $15.7K in the last week of December and saw another high of $11.1K in the final week of March. Downloads started at around 560 and ended at approximately 434 by the end of March. Active users showed slight fluctuations, maintaining around 2.7K to 3.3K throughout the quarter.

Zooba: Zoo Battle Royale Games experienced consistent revenue growth, peaking at around $11.2K in the third week of March. Downloads saw an increase towards the end of the quarter, rising from around 2K in late December to about 1.7K by the end of March. Active users remained fairly stable, fluctuating between 11K and 14K throughout the quarter.

War Machines: Battle Tank Games had a steady revenue trend with a peak of around $9.9K in the second week of January. Downloads started at around 1K and ended at approximately 606 by the end of March. Active users remained relatively stable, ranging from about 9.7K to 11.6K throughout the quarter.
